WebDec 11, 2024 · For starters, there's the spherical universe, where an airplane sent in one direction ultimately comes back around, as is the case on Earth. A triangle in this universe has angles adding up to more than 180 degrees. Parallel lines ultimately meet, just like two friends walking parallel to each other on their way to the North Pole. If k = +1 the manifold represented by the Robertson-Walker metric is a finite spherical space, so it is called "closed".
